Kimberly City Water Bond Issue (November 2009)
There was a Kimberly City Water Bond Issue on the November 3 ballot in Twin Falls County for voters in the city of Kimberly.
The bond issue asked voters if they wanted to approve a loan from the state government, totaling $6.6 million with the first million forgiven in paying back. The money would be used to update and improve the cities water system.[1]
